Thanks for visiting our page. We are organising our own event this year which is a bikepacking trip to cycle The Cairngorms Loop. As the name suggests, the ride is based in the Cairngorms and is approx 181 miles in length with approx 11000ft of climbing involved. 2 of us taking part are riding singlespeed and we are all sleeping outdoors for the duration of the ride which we are aiming to complete in 4 days all being well. We will be carrying all of our sleeping kit aswell as food and supplies on the bikes.
